Deep Dive / 02
01

Methods that survive production

We prioritize architectures and training tricks that remain stable when data is messy and compute is constrained. Reproducible recipes — not one-off leaderboard runs — are the unit of progress.

02

Shared instrumentation

Labs share training frameworks, eval harnesses, and cluster quotas so Vision, AI Systems, and Robotics researchers build on common deep learning primitives.

03

From theory to stack

Successful methods graduate into Foundation Models, Vision Systems, and product SDKs. Deep Learning technology is the research root of the vertically integrated stack.
